WebThin-set mortar for tiles and counter tops, for example, takes 24 to 48 hours to dry, whereas brick mortar made of Portland cement can take up to 28 days. How quickly does mortar set up, one might wonder? Mortar and other concrete products typically reach 95% of their strength in seven days. WebMortar dries more quickly than it cures. In most cases, the mortar will be dry to the touch within a few hours. However, it can take up to 28 days for the mortar to cure completely. …
